The 7:30 pm Shiners performance: what actually happens on stage

Adult Comedy Show & Cirque-Style Performance at Woolworth Theatre - The 7:30 pm Shiners performance: what actually happens on stage
The show runs about 1.5 hours, starting at 7:30 pm. From the moment it begins, the performance feeds you the Shiner story—an eclectic, lovable family of moonshiners gathered for a wild family reunion.

Then the acts start doing what cirque does best: combining athleticism with showmanship. Expect high-flying aerialists and gravity-defying strong-man energy, the kind of physical work that makes you instinctively think, Will they land it? Then they land it.

Comedy comes right alongside the stunts. This isn’t a separate “comedy show then a circus show” format. The humor is part of the rhythm, and the show leans into audience involvement at points, so it can feel like you’re part of the party rather than a spectator behind a rope.

There’s also a game-show style segment in the mix, with audience participation and quick jokes. The exact flow can feel slightly uneven to some people, but the big takeaway is this: the energy stays high, and the cast is clearly performing for the room, not for a camera.

Timing, lines, and how to plan your night in Nashville

Adult Comedy Show & Cirque-Style Performance at Woolworth Theatre - Timing, lines, and how to plan your night in Nashville
Plan for a 7:30 pm start. People have noted there can be a long line to get in, but the check-in moves quickly once you’re at the front. So arrive with buffer time, especially if you’re coming straight from dinner.

The show is near public transportation, which helps if you don’t want to fight parking. Private transportation isn’t included, so if you’re staying farther out, you’ll want to plan your ride or transit ahead of time.

A useful planning detail: on average, this show is booked about 18 days in advance. That doesn’t mean you’ll always need to book early, but it’s a sign you should reserve sooner rather than later if you’re traveling around peak dates.

Also remember: the experience is non-refundable and can’t be changed once booked. That matters if your schedule is flexible. If you might rethink your plans last minute, you’ll want to consider that risk before you pull the trigger.
